Just In: House of Reps rejects lifting of Twitter ban
<p>The House of Representatives, has on Thursday, July 1, rejected the lifting the ban place on the micro-blogging platform, Twitter.</p>

<p>This coming after the house received reports from its committees on Information, ICT, Intelligence, Justice and Orientation who investigated the circumstances of the suspension by the federal government</p>
<p>After reviewing the report, the Deputy Minority Leader of the House, Toby Okechukwu, suggested that federal government should take into cognizance the negative effect of the Twitter suspension on Nigerians who depend on the platform for their livelihood and lift the suspension.</p>
<p>However, seconded by another member, the motion was rejected by the majority of the House when put to vote.</p>
